: Rabbi Fetaya's "Minhat Yehuda" is a profound and wide-ranging kabbalistic commentary on the entire Tanakh (Hebrew Bible). It is also a deeply personal work, as the author shares his experiences and methods regarding dybbuks (possessing spirits) and exorcism, making it a significant source for the study of Jewish demonology and practical Kabbalah. Another highly sought-after text is the Teshuvot Minhat Yehuda (Responsa of Minhat Yehuda) by Rabbi Yehuda Aszod (1794–1866), a leading Hungarian rabbinic authority. This collection contains practical questions and answers regarding complex issues in Jewish law, serving as a cornerstone for modern Halachic rulings. The Kabbalistic Work of Rabbi Yehuda Fatiyah
